Default BIOS Reset


I have a AMD Based PC with ECS Motherboard. My Mother board model is K8M800 - M2 (http://www.ecs.com.tw/ECSWebSite/Pro...nuID=1&LanID=9)
Recently my system is not booting properly. most of the time it doesnt even POST. Every time i have to start the PC i had to clear the cmos (using jumper) and then the PC will start fine. Once its ON i dont see any instability even after 4 hours of working with it. I have upgraded the BIOS (Flashed) too using the tools provided in the Mother board website. I have check with a different SMPS but even that does not help. Replacing the mother will work (i guess) but is there any repair/mod way out?
Note : I have replaced the CMOS Battery too
